Transaction 66e7c971b5f6bed20d61a22c1cfec1af4baaa8d4cdfd808ce6ed007e320af0d8
1 Input
1 Output
-
66e7c971b5f6bed20d61a22c1cfec1af4baaa8d4cdfd808ce6ed007e320af0d8:0
- value
- 2372880
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7daf40a1a55885e7b88faa7ba2f8aa26a43ab5fa O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CTZQjYzkcpZv5gu2AHotPkaDhsb6MvbNw